Vancouver, British Columbia, March 22, 2021 – Genix Pharmaceuticals Corporation (TSX-V: GENX) (“GENIX” or the “Company”) GENIX is pleased to announce that it has entered into an agreement with a regulatory consulting company to prepare and file Abbreviated New Drug Submissions (ANDS) with Health Canada for the first 10 of its 30 generic ophthalmic drugs, acquired by the Company. dolore eu fugiat nulla pariatur.

An ANDS is an application to Health Canada to approve a prescription generic pharmaceutical for sale in Canada. Upon approval of an ANDS, Health Canada issues the applicant with a Marketing Authorization and Drug Identification Number (DIN), which allows the applicant to legally sell the drug in Canada. Upon submission of these ten ANDS applications, the Company expects to receive Health Canada approvals and issuance of these DINs within 12 months.

Upon completion of the first ten ANDS filings, the Company shall immediately proceed with the ANDS filings of the remaining twenty ophthalmic drugs in GENIX’s portfolio.

The Company would also like to announce the appointment of Mr. Paul Chow to the Company’s Board of Directors. Mr. Chow has served in the capital markets for over two decades providing corporate advisory services and acting as a director and/or senior officer with several private and public companies throughout North America. He has helped companies develop their business model through strategic planning, corporate finance, business development and marketing. Most recently he has led Next Green Wave Holdings Inc. (CSE: NGW) (OTCQX:NXGWF) – an integrated cannabis producer with manufacturing facilities in California, to successfully list on the Canadian Securities Exchange and the OTCQX in United States. As a founding partner, he was instrumental in the development of the board and management team, financing, IPO listing and developing the corporate strategies from start-up into a strong revenue and cash flow producer.
